R. Bhavani is a scholar working on Computer Vision and Pattern Recognition, Artificial Intelligence and Biomedical Engineering. According to data from OpenAlex, R. Bhavani has authored 29 papers receiving a total of 205 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Computer Vision and Pattern Recognition, 6 papers in Artificial Intelligence and 5 papers in Biomedical Engineering. Recurrent topics in R. Bhavani’s work include Human Pose and Action Recognition (6 papers), Medical Image Segmentation Techniques (4 papers) and AI in cancer detection (4 papers). R. Bhavani is often cited by papers focused on Human Pose and Action Recognition (6 papers), Medical Image Segmentation Techniques (4 papers) and AI in cancer detection (4 papers). R. Bhavani collaborates with scholars based in India and Sudan. R. Bhavani's co-authors include K. P. Sanal Kumar, Solomon F.D. Paul, P. Aruna, Rajesh Singh and Sheshang Degadwala and has published in prestigious journals such as Measurement, Multimedia Tools and Applications and Journal of Ambient Intelligence and Humanized Computing.
